Why Does Dog Urine Burn Grass?

Dog urine is high in nitrogen, which is actually a natural fertilizer — but too much of it in one concentrated spot has the same effect as over-fertilizing: it burns the grass. Female dogs tend to cause more visible damage, not because of their biology, but because they squat in one place, delivering a concentrated stream to one area.

Other Tips to Protect Your Lawn

While supplements can help, they work best when combined with other strategies:

  • Water the area right after your dog pees to dilute the nitrogen.
  • Train your dog to go in one designated spot.
  • Feed a high-quality, balanced diet to reduce excess protein waste.
